Questions You Might Need to Know About Traveling to Gelnhausen
Gelnhausen is a charming historical town in Hesse, Germany, renowned for its medieval architecture and fairy-tale atmosphere. As one of the hometowns of the Brothers Grimm, its half-timbered houses and cobblestone streets evoke storybook scenes. The Gelnhausen Imperial Palace stands as a landmark showcasing Renaissance architecture.
Top attractions include the Gelnhausen Imperial Palace, a 16th-century castle now housing a local history museum. The well-preserved Old Town half-timbered ensemble around Market Square is exceptional. The Fairy Tale Route passes through here, and summer medieval markets offer traditional crafts demonstrations.
Local cuisine features Hessian specialties like "Grüne Soße" (green herb sauce with potatoes and eggs). Apple wine (Apfelwein) paired with "Handkäs mit Musik" (marinated cheese) is a must-try. Authentic traditional taverns in the Old Town provide immersive dining experiences.
Gelnhausen is best explored on foot, with buses serving longer distances. The RMV regional train connects to Frankfurt (1-hour ride). Drivers should note pedestrian zones in the Old Town and use peripheral parking lots.
Visit between May-September for mild weather and festivals. The Christmas market (Nov-Dec) is magical but requires warm clothing. Summer sees more tourists - weekdays offer quieter visits.
German is primary language, with basic English in tourist areas. Free WiFi hotspots require mobile verification. Cash dominates payments; credit cards accepted mainly at hotels/upscale restaurants. Emergency: 112. 24-hour pharmacies marked "Apotheke". Voltage 230V with Europlug (Type C/F). EU health cards cover medical care, others pay privately.
